About this inn

Located in Puerto Escondido, a 5-minute walk from Playa Puerto Ángelito, Hotel Posada Playa Manzanillo provides accommodations with an outdoor swimming pool, free private parking and a garden.

    I would stay there again!
    Wonderful family running hotel. Very basic, that is what I expected but clean and perfect location of maybe 5-10 minute walk to Manzanillo beach. I had a room with no air conditioning but the fan was excellent. The little wade pools were nice when getting back from walking anywhere in the heat for a quick cool down. Very central to everything, 10 min walk to Rinconada or to the night market area and many little restaurants nearby. Safe location and easy access to taxis even though not a major road. The sunsets at the end of the road were stunning.

    Conveniently located, very clean & nice rooms
    Very clean rooms and very comfortable beds! Hot shower. Windows covered with mosquito netting so you could let in a breeze, but there is also a fan. Another big plus was the proximity/walking distance to the ADO station and Playa Principal (dolphin watching tours) in one direction as well as several other smaller beaches in the other direction.
